Last year i purchased a superb one owner MK 3 astra F 1997 GL 1600 16v 4 door from an elderly gentleman who had kept it in a heated garage .This car would be our summer run about ,but unfortunately i have hit a problem and i need some advice .We need a tow bar on the car as we have a Thule bike rack and love to take the bikes to the forest where its safer to ride .
I have tried in vain to get the correct tow bar even the fitter has tried ,Watling tow bars sent the incorrect bar even though they insisted it was the right one for this model but were good enough to refund the cost and my fitter had the incorrect one sent to him and had to refund me . It would seem the boot floor pan is different to other MK 3 astras the only one that would fit is from Bosal but the company no longer exists Part no 017-852 type Nr -30A 1991 -2004 .None of the other tow bars listed by companies for this car fit it.
Has anyone come across this before i would not normally fit a tow bar on a classic but the bosal design is removable and does not involve cutting the bumper plus we dont intend to tow anything else . ANY HELP WOULD BE APPRECIATED . Thanks Richard

Found one and they have it in stock ! Only problem is its sold by "Rameder "in germany which is part of "oris/ Autodoc "".went on their site BUT they do not post to the UK they do however post to Ireland though .
E,mailed the director (no response) and their sales team told me the item is too heavy to post !
The part you need looks like Auto-Hak rigid towbar part no 143785-00388-1.
The main bar fits INSIDE the boot and is bolted to the inner floor on both sides and through the back panel.
On another note it seems parts are becoming harder to find for these cars left hand drive shafts seem non existant .
